What is Kumu?

Kumu is a powerful yet intuitive software for data visualization, mapping systems, and analyzing relationships between concepts and ideas. It allows users to create customizable networked models and relational maps to visually represent complex systems, ideas, data, processes, organizations, and more.

Some key features of Kumu include:

  • Interactive and dynamic maps that can be shared and collaborated on with others
  • Diverse visual elements like nodes, links, labels, images, clusters, and more to represent a system
  • Real-time editing and multiple views to see the system from different angles
  • Import/export options to bring in data from other sources or export maps
  • Integrations with other applications through API and other extensions
  • Secure environment with ability to make maps private or public

Kumu is an ideal software for systems thinkers, data analysts, researchers, organizers, educators and businesses who want to map systems and relationships to gain deeper understanding and insights for better decision making and strategy. Its intuitive user interface makes it easy to get started for even non-experts.
